diff options
author | Vladimir Sementsov-Ogievskiy <vsementsov@virtuozzo.com> | 2018-03-13 15:34:01 -0400 |
---|---|---|
committer | John Snow <jsnow@redhat.com> | 2018-03-13 17:06:09 -0400 |
commit | b35ebdf076d697bca9ad8715ac76d7b7f3ac1be3 (patch) | |
tree | 7aa0608119de0b525ec65e8827d311b72636f154 /vl.c | |
parent | 16b0fd3252511af284ceaeedb4d09ce2d5142da0 (diff) | |
download | qemu-b35ebdf076d697bca9ad8715ac76d7b7f3ac1be3.zip qemu-b35ebdf076d697bca9ad8715ac76d7b7f3ac1be3.tar.gz qemu-b35ebdf076d697bca9ad8715ac76d7b7f3ac1be3.tar.bz2 |
migration: add postcopy migration of dirty bitmaps
Postcopy migration of dirty bitmaps. Only named dirty bitmaps are migrated.
If destination qemu is already containing a dirty bitmap with the same name
as a migrated bitmap (for the same node), then, if their granularities are
the same the migration will be done, otherwise the error will be generated.
If destination qemu doesn't contain such bitmap it will be created.
Signed-off-by: Vladimir Sementsov-Ogievskiy <vsementsov@virtuozzo.com>
Reviewed-by: Dr. David Alan Gilbert <dgilbert@redhat.com>
Message-id: 20180313180320.339796-12-vsementsov@virtuozzo.com
[Changed '+' to '*' as per list discussion. --js]
Signed-off-by: John Snow <jsnow@redhat.com>
Diffstat (limited to 'vl.c')
-rw-r--r-- | vl.c | 1 |
1 files changed, 1 insertions, 0 deletions
@@ -4502,6 +4502,7 @@ int main(int argc, char **argv, char **envp) blk_mig_init(); ram_mig_init(); + dirty_bitmap_mig_init(); /* If the currently selected machine wishes to override the units-per-bus * property of its default HBA interface type, do so now. */ |